Actinomycosis is a rare chronic suppurative granulomatous disease. Surgical biopsy is often performed in patients with chest actinomycosis because malignancy is suspected in most cases. A 62-year-old man presented to our hospital with fever and exertional dyspnea that had persisted for several months. Contrast-enhanced computed tomography showed an irregularly shaped mass with contrast enhancement in the anterior mediastinum and consolidation in the left upper lung lobe contiguous with this mass, as well as multiple nodules in both lungs. The pulmonary artery trunk was stenotic and surrounded by the mass, and the right heart system was enlarged. Thoracoscopic biopsy was performed but failed to yield a diagnosis. Contrast-enhanced computed tomography after one month revealed an increased mass and worsening right heart strain. 18F-FDG (fluorodeoxyglucose) positron emission tomography/computed tomography and contrast-enhanced magnetic resonance imaging also suggested a malignant tumor, and an open chest biopsy was performed. No malignant cells were identified and actinomycetes were detected by histopathology and bacterial culture. The patient was treated with antibiotics, following which his contrast-enhanced computed tomography findings and general condition improved.

BACKGROUND AND AIMS: We compared ERCP using a balloon-assisted endoscope (BE-ERCP) with EUS-guided antegrade treatment (EUS-AG) for removal of common bile duct (CBD) stones in patients with Roux-en-Y (R-Y) gastrectomy. METHODS: Consecutive patients who had previous R-Y gastrectomy undergoing BE-ERCP or EUS-AG for CBD stones in 16 centers were retrospectively analyzed. RESULTS: BE-ERCP and EUS-AG were performed in 588 and 59 patients, respectively. Baseline characteristics were similar, except for CBD diameter and angle. The technical success rate was 83.7% versus 83.1% (P = .956), complete stone removal rate was 78.1% versus 67.8% (P = .102), and early adverse event rate was 10.2% versus 18.6% (P = .076) in BE-ERCP and EUS-AG, respectively. The mean number of endoscopic sessions was smaller in BE-ERCP (1.5 ± .8 vs 1.9 ± 1.0 sessions, P = .01), whereas the median total treatment time was longer (90 vs 61.5 minutes, P = .001). Among patients with biliary access, the complete stone removal rate was significantly higher in BE-ERCP (93.3% vs 81.6%, P = .009). Negative predictive factors were CBD diameter ≥15 mm (odds ratio [OR], .41) and an angle of CBD <90 degrees (OR, .39) in BE-ERCP and a stone size ≥10 mm (OR, .07) and an angle of CBD <90 degrees (OR, .07) in EUS-AG. The 1-year recurrence rate was 8.3% in both groups. CONCLUSIONS: Effectiveness and safety of BE-ERCP and EUS-AG were comparable in CBD stone removal for patients after R-Y gastrectomy, but complete stone removal after technical success was superior in BE-ERCP.

OBJECTIVES: No comprehensive study has examined short- and long-term adverse outcomes of endoscopic ultrasound (EUS)-guided treatment of pancreatic fluid collections (PFCs) including walled-off necrosis (WON) and pseudocysts. METHODS: In a multi-institutional cohort of 357 patients receiving EUS-guided treatment of PFCs (228 with WON and 129 with pseudocysts), we examined PFC type-specific risk factors for procedure-related adverse events (AEs), clinical failure, and recurrence. Odds ratios (ORs) and hazard ratios (HRs) with 95% confidence intervals (CIs) were computed using the logistic and Cox regression models, respectively, adjusting for potential confounders. RESULTS: Adverse events were observed predominantly in WON, and risk factors were WON extension to the pelvis (OR 2.49; 95% CI 1.00-6.19) and endoscopic necrosectomy (OR 5.15; 95% CI 1.61-16.5). Risk factors for clinical failure in WON treatment included higher Charlson Comorbidity Index (OR for ≥3 vs. ≤2, 2.58; 95% CI 1.05-6.35), extension to the pelvis (OR 3.63; 95% CI 1.57-8.43), nonuse of a lumen-apposing metal stent (OR 2.88; 95% CI 1.10-7.54), and percutaneous drainage (OR 3.73; 95% CI 1.27-10.9). Patients with pseudocysts extending to the paracolic gutter and the need for more than two endoscopic/percutaneous procedures had ORs for clinical failure of 5.28 (95% CI 1.10-25.3) and 5.52 (95% CI 1.61-18.9), respectively. Pseudocysts requiring the multigateway approach were associated with a high risk of recurrence (HR 4.00; 95% CI 1.11-11.6). CONCLUSION: The adverse outcomes at various phases of EUS-guided PFC treatment may be predictable based on clinical parameters. Further research is warranted to optimize treatment strategies for high-risk patients.

BACKGROUND: With the increasing popularity of endoscopic ultrasound (EUS)-guided transmural interventions, walled-off necrosis (WON) of the pancreas is increasingly managed via non-surgical endoscopic interventions. However, there has been an ongoing debate over the appropriate treatment strategy following the initial EUS-guided drainage. Direct endoscopic necrosectomy (DEN) removes intracavity necrotic tissue, potentially facilitating early resolution of the WON, but may associate with a high rate of adverse events. Given the increasing safety of DEN, we hypothesised that immediate DEN following EUS-guided drainage of WON might shorten the time to WON resolution compared to the drainage-oriented step-up approach. METHODS: The WONDER-01 trial is a multicentre, open-label, superiority, randomised controlled trial, which will enrol WON patients aged ≥ 18 years requiring EUS-guided treatment in 23 centres in Japan. This trial plans to enrol 70 patients who will be randomised at a 1:1 ratio to receive either the immediate DEN or drainage-oriented step-up approach (35 patients per arm). In the immediate DEN group, DEN will be initiated during (or within 72 h of) the EUS-guided drainage session. In the step-up approach group, drainage-based step-up treatment with on-demand DEN will be considered after 72-96 h observation. The primary endpoint is time to clinical success, which is defined as a decrease in a WON size to ≤ 3 cm and an improvement of inflammatory markers (i.e. body temperature, white blood cell count, and C-reactive protein). Secondary endpoints include technical success, adverse events including mortality, and recurrence of the WON. DISCUSSION: The WONDER-01 trial will investigate the efficacy and safety of immediate DEN compared to the step-up approach for WON patients receiving EUS-guided treatment. The findings will help us to establish new treatment standards for patients with symptomatic WON. TRIAL REGISTRATION: ClinicalTrials.gov NCT05451901, registered on 11 July 2022. UMIN000048310, registered on 7 July 2022. jRCT1032220055, registered on 1 May 2022.

BACKGROUND AND AIMS: A novel EUS-guided fine-needle biopsy sampling (EUS-FNB) needle enabled physicians to obtain sufficient pathologic samples with fewer to-and-fro movements (TAFs) within the lesion. We compared the diagnostic yields of EUS-FNB with 3 and 12 TAFs at each puncture pass. METHODS: The primary endpoint of this multicenter, noninferiority, crossover, randomized controlled trial involving 6 centers was diagnostic sensitivity. Secondary endpoints were diagnostic accuracy and quantity and quality evaluation of EUS-FNB specimens. Length of the macroscopically visible core (MVC) and microscopic histologic quantity were used for quantitative evaluation. Macroscopic visual and microscopic histologic evaluations were performed for qualitative evaluation. RESULTS: Among 110 patients (220 punctures, 110 for 3 TAFs and 12 TAFs each), 105 (210 punctures) had malignant histology. Diagnostic sensitivity for malignancy of 3 TAFs (88.6%) was not inferior to that of 12 TAFs (89.5%; difference, -.9%; 95% confidence interval, -9.81 to 7.86). Diagnostic accuracy for malignancy was 92.7% for 3 TAFs and 94.6% for 12 TAFs. Overall median MVC length was 13.5 mm in both groups. The 3-TAF group had a significantly higher rate of score ≥3 on macroscopic visual quality evaluation than the 12-TAF group (71.8% vs 52.7%, P = .009). No significant intergroup differences existed in microscopic histologic quantity and quality evaluations (quantity evaluation, 88.2% for 3 TAFs vs 83.6% for 12 TAFs; quality evaluation, 90.0% for 3 TAFs vs 89.1% for 12 TAFs). CONCLUSIONS: Diagnostic sensitivity and accuracy of EUS-FNB with 3 TAFs were not inferior to those with 12 TAFs for solid pancreatic lesions. The 3-TAF group showed significantly less blood contamination in sampled tissues than the 12-TAF group. (Clinical trial registration number: UMIN000037309.).

BACKGROUND AND AIM: Dedicated studies evaluating the impact of COVID-19 on outcomes of pancreatobiliary IgG4 related disease (IgG4-RD) patients are scarce. Whether COVID-19 infection or vaccination would trigger IgG4-RD exacerbation remains unknown. METHODS: Pancreatobiliary IgG4-RD patients ≥ 18 years old with active follow-up since January 2020 from nine referral centers in Asia, Europe, and North America were included in this multicenter retrospective study. Outcome measures include incidence and severity of COVID-19 infection, IgG4-RD disease activity and treatment status, interruption of indicated IgG4-RD treatment. Prospective data on COVID-19 vaccination status and new COVID-19 infection during the Omicron outbreak were also retrieved in the Hong Kong cohort. RESULTS: Of the 124 pancreatobiliary IgG4-RD patients, 25.0% had active IgG4-RD, 71.0% were on immunosuppressive therapies and 80.6% had ≥ 1 risk factor for severe COVID. In 2020 (pre-vaccination period), two patients (1.6%) had COVID-19 infection (one requiring ICU admission), and 7.2% of patients had interruptions in indicated immunosuppressive treatment for IgG4-RD. Despite a high vaccination rate (85.0%), COVID-19 infection rate has increased to 20.0% during Omicron outbreak in the Hong Kong cohort. A trend towards higher COVID-19 infection rate was noted in the non-fully vaccinated/unvaccinated group (17.6% vs 33.3%, P = 0.376). No IgG4-RD exacerbation following COVID-19 vaccination or infection was observed. CONCLUSION: While a low COVID-19 infection rate with no mortality was observed in pancreatobiliary IgG4-RD patients in the pre-vaccination period of COVID-19, infection rate has increased during the Omicron outbreak despite a high vaccination rate. No IgG4-RD exacerbation after COVID-19 infection or vaccination was observed.

Pancreatic fluid collections (PFCs) commonly develop as complications of acute pancreatitis and ductal disruption due to chronic pancreatitis. In the revised Atlanta classification, PFCs were classified based on the presence of necrosis and duration following the onset of acute pancreatitis. Interventions are required in cases of symptomatic pancreatic pseudocysts or walled-off necrosis (WON). In the management of these PFCs, endoscopic ultrasound-guided transluminal drainage and subsequent direct endoscopic necrosectomy for WON are increasingly utilized as less invasive treatment modalities compared to surgical debridement. To date, researchers have focused predominantly on the technical aspects of endoscopic therapy for symptomatic PFCs. Given the poor physical condition of patients receiving endoscopic treatment for PFCs, systemic support may have a substantial impact on the short- and long-term outcomes of these patients. A multidisciplinary approach is required to improve the clinical outcomes of patients with infected PFCs and their associated comorbidities. However, non-interventional support during the periprocedural period of endoscopic treatment of PFCs has not been fully discussed, and there have been considerable variations in the selection of treatment options between endoscopists and centers. To address these unmet needs in the clinical management of PFCs and promote future research to improve the clinical outcomes, we conducted a review of the literature within a multicenter consortium of expert endoscopists with specific expertise in the endoscopic treatment of PFCs. In this review, we summarize the current evidence on non-interventional supportive care (e.g., continuous lavage, medications, nutritional support, and antimicrobials) and propose potential topics for future research.

BACKGROUND AND PURPOSE: Hepatic steatosis may be associated with an increased γ-glutamyltransferase (γ-GT) levels. Ischaemia-reoxygenation (IR) injury causes several deleterious effects. We evaluated the protective effects of a selective inhibitor of γ-GT in experimentally induced IR injury in rats with obesity and steatosis. EXPERIMENTAL APPROACH: Otsuka Long-Evans Tokushima Fatty (OLETF) rats with hepatic steatosis were used in the current study. The portal vein and hepatic artery of left lateral and median lobes were clamped to induce ischaemia. Before clamping, 1 ml of saline (IR group) or 1-ml saline containing 1 mg·kg-1 body weight of GGsTop (γ-GT inhibitor; IR-GGsTop group) was injected into the liver via the inferior vena cava. Blood flow was restored after at 30 min of the start of ischaemia. Blood was collected before, at 30 min after ischaemia and at 2 h and 6 h after reoxygenation. All the animals were killed at 6 h and the livers were collected. KEY RESULTS: Treatment with GGsTop resulted in significant reduction of serum ALT, AST and γ-GT levels and hepatic γ-GT, malondialdehyde, 4-hydroxy-2-nonenal and HMGB1 at 6 h after reoxygenation. Inhibition of γ-GT retained normal hepatic glutathione levels. There was prominent hepatic necrosis in IR group, which is significantly reduced in IR-GGsTop group. CONCLUSION AND IMPLICATIONS: Treatment with GGsTop significantly increased hepatic glutathione content, reduced hepatic MDA, 4-HNE and HMGB1 levels and, remarkably, ameliorated hepatic necrosis after ischaemia-reoxygenation. The results indicated that GGsTop could be an appropriate therapeutic agent to reduce IR-induced liver injury in obesity and steatosis.

Background/aim: To elucidate how the combination of fatty liver and increased serum gamma-glutamyl transpeptidase (GGT) levels influences atherosclerotic plaque development in apparently healthy people. Materials and methods: The study population included people who had received an annual health checkup for more than 7 years and had no evidence of carotid plaque at baseline. We investigated the risk factors for carotid plaque occurrence using the Cox proportional hazards model. Results: A total of 107 people (76 men and 31 women; median age, 49 years) were enrolled. At baseline, fatty liver and a serum GGT level ≥50 U/L were observed in 13 and 38 people, respectively. During a median follow-up period of 13.3 years, carotid plaques appeared in 34 people. Multivariate analysis revealed that the combination of fatty liver and a serum GGT level ≥50 U/L was the only significant risk factor for carotid plaque occurrence (age- and sex-adjusted hazard ratio: 5.55; 95% confidence interval 1.70­18.14; P = 0.005). Conclusion: The combination of fatty liver and increased serum GGT levels raises the risk for atherosclerotic plaque development in apparently healthy people.

Recombinant thrombomodulin (rTM) is a novel anticoagulant and anti-inflammatory agent that inhibits secretion of high-mobility group box 1 (HMGB1) from liver. We evaluated the protective effects of rTM on hepatic ischemia-reperfusion injury in rats. Ischemia was induced by clamping the portal vein and hepatic artery of left lateral and median lobes of the liver. At 30 min before ischemia and at 6 h after reperfusion, 0.3 ml of saline (IR group) or 0.3 ml of saline containing 6 mg/kg body weight of rTM (IR-rTM group) was injected into the liver through inferior vena cava or caudate vein. Blood flow was restored at 60 min of ischemia. Blood was collected 30 min prior to induction of ischemia and before restoration of blood flow, and at 6, 12, and 24 h after reperfusion. All the animals were euthanized at 24 h after reperfusion and the livers were harvested and subjected to biochemical and pathological evaluations. Serum levels of ALT, AST, and HMGB1 were significantly lower after reperfusion in the IR-rTM group compared to IR group. Marked hepatic necrosis was present in the IR group, while necrosis was almost absent in IR-rTM group. Treatment with rTM significantly reduced the expression of TNF-α and formation of 4-hydroxynonenal in the IR-rTM group compared to IR group. The results of the present study indicate that rTM could be used as a potent therapeutic agent to prevent IR-induced hepatic injury and the related adverse events.

BACKGROUND: During ultrasound-guided radiofrequency ablation (RFA) of hepatocellular carcinoma (HCC), high echoic areas due to RFA-induced microbubbles can help calculate the extent of ablation. However, these areas also decrease visualization of target tumors, making it difficult to assess whether they completely cover the tumors. To estimate the effects of RFA more precisely, we used an image fusion system (IFS). PATIENTS AND METHODS: We enrolled patients with a single HCC who received RFA with or without the IFS. In the IFS group, we drew a spherical marker along the contour of a target tumor on reference images immediately after administering RFA so that the synchronized spherical marker represented the contour of the target tumor on real-time ultrasound images. When the high echoic area completely covered the marker, we considered the ablation to be complete. We compared outcomes between the IFS and control groups. RESULTS: We enrolled 25 patients and 20 controls, and the baseline characteristics were similar between the two groups. The complete ablation rates during the first RFA session were significantly higher in the IFS group compared with those in the control group (88.0% vs. 60.0%, P = 0.041). The number of RFA sessions was significantly smaller in the IFS group compared with that in the control group (1.1 ± 0.3 vs. 1.5 ± 0.7, P = 0.016). CONCLUSIONS: The study suggested that the IFS enables a more precise estimation of the effects of RFA on HCC, contributing to enhanced treatment efficacy and minimized patient burden.

Ischemia-reperfusion (IR) injury is a major clinical problem and is associated with numerous adverse effects. GGsTop [2-amino-4{[3-(carboxymethyl)phenyl](methyl)phosphono}butanoic acid] is a highly specific and irreversible γ-glutamyl transpeptidase (γ-GT) inhibitor. We studied the protective effects of GGsTop on IR-induced hepatic injury in rats. Ischemia was induced by clamping the portal vein and hepatic artery of left lateral and median lobes of the liver. Before clamping, saline (IR group) or saline containing 1 mg/kg body wt of GGsTop (IR-GGsTop group) was injected into the liver through the inferior vena cava. At 90 min of ischemia, blood flow was restored. Blood was collected before induction of ischemia and prior to restoration of blood flow and at 12, 24, and 48 h after reperfusion. All the animals were euthanized at 48 h after reperfusion and the livers were harvested. Serum levels of alanine transaminase, aspartate transaminase, and γ-GT were significantly lower after reperfusion in the IR-GGsTop group compared with the IR group. Massive hepatic necrosis was present in the IR group, while only few necroses were present in the IR-GGsTop group. Treatment with GGsTop increased hepatic GSH content, which was significantly reduced in the IR group. Furthermore, GGsTop prevented increase of hepatic γ-GT, malondialdehyde, 4-hydroxynonenal, and TNF-α while all these molecules significantly increased in the IR group. In conclusion, treatment with GGsTop increased glutathione levels and prevented formation of free radicals in the hepatic tissue that led to decreased IR-induced liver injury. GGsTop could be used as a pharmacological agent to prevent IR-induced liver injury and the related adverse events.

We propose a thin and compact concentrator photovoltaic (CPV) module, about 20 mm thick, one tenth thinner than those of conventional CPVs that are widely deployed for mega-solar systems, to broaden CPV application scenarios. We achieved an energy conversion efficiency of 37.1% at a module temperature of 25 °C under sunlight irradiation optimized for our module. Our CPV module has a lens array consisting of 10 mm-square unit lenses and micro solar cells that are directly attached to the lens array, to reduce the focal length of the concentrator and to reduce optical losses due to reflection. The optical loss of the lens in our module is about 9.0%, which is lower than that of conventional CPV modules with secondary optics. This low optical loss enables our CPV module to achieve a high energy conversion efficiency.

BACKGROUND & AIMS: Osteopontin (OPN) is a matricellular protein that upregulates during pathogenesis of hepatic fibrosis. The present study was aimed to evaluate whether serum OPN could be used as a biomarker to assess the degree of hepatic fibrosis in patients with hepatitis C virus (HCV) infection. METHODS: Needle biopsy was performed on HCV patients and scored as zero fibrosis (F0), mild fibrosis (F1), moderate fibrosis (F2), severe fibrosis (F3) and liver cirrhosis (F4) based on Masson's trichrome and α-smooth muscle actin (α-SMA) staining. Serum OPN levels were measured using ELISA and correlated with the degree of fibrosis. Furthermore, the OPN values were correlated and evaluated with platelets count, serum hyaluronic acid (HA), and collagen type IV and subjected to receiver operating characteristic (ROC) curve analysis. RESULTS: Serum OPN levels were remarkably increased from F0 through F4 in a progressive manner and the differences were significant (P < 0.001) between each group. The data were highly correlated with the degree of hepatic fibrosis. The ROC curve analysis depicted that serum OPN is an independent risk factor and an excellent biomarker and a prognostic index in HCV patients. CONCLUSIONS: The results of the present study indicate that serum OPN levels reflect the degree of hepatic fibrosis and could be used as a biomarker to assess the stage of fibrosis in HCV patients which would help to reduce the number of liver biopsies. Furthermore, serum OPN serves as a prognostic index towards the progression of hepatic fibrosis to cirrhosis and hepatocellular carcinoma.

The pathogenesis of nonalcoholic steatohepatitis (NASH) is a two-stage process in which steatosis is the "first hit" and an unknown "second hit." We hypothesized that "a binge" could be a "second hit" to develop NASH from obesity-induced simple steatosis. Thirty-week-old male Otsuka Long-Evans Tokushima fatty (OLETF) rats were administered 10 mL of 10% ethanol orally for 5, 3, 2, and 1 d/wk for 3 consecutive weeks. As control, male Otsuka Long-Evans Tokushima (OLET) rats were administered the same amount of alcohol. Various biochemical parameters of obesity, steatosis and NASH were monitored in serum and liver specimens in untreated and ethanol-treated rats. The liver sections were evaluated for histopathological alterations of NASH and stained for cytochrome P-4502E1 (CYP2E1) and 4-hydroxy-nonenal (4-HNE). Simple steatosis, hyperinsulinemia, hyperglycemia, insulin resistance, hypertriglycemia and marked increases in hepatic CYP2E1 and 4-HNE were present in 30-wk-old untreated OLETF rats. Massive steatohepatitis with hepatocyte ballooning was observed in the livers of all OLETF rats treated with ethanol. Serum and hepatic triglyceride levels as well as tumor necrosis factor (TNF)-α mRNA were markedly increased in all ethanol-treated OLETF rats. Staining for CYP2E1 and 4-NHE demonstrated marked increases in the hepatic tissue of all the groups of OLETF rats treated with ethanol compared with OLET rats. Our data demonstrated that "a binge" serves as a "second hit" for development of NASH from obesity-induced simple steatosis through aggravation of oxidative stress. The enhanced levels of CYP2E1 and increased oxidative stress in obesity play a significant role in this process.

BACKGROUND: Radiofrequency ablation (RFA) is a curative therapy for hepatocellular carcinoma (HCC). In RFA, ultrasonography (US) is most commonly used to guide tumor puncture, while its effects are assessed using dynamic computed tomography or magnetic resonance. The differences in modalities used for RFA and assessment of its effects complicate RFA. We developed a method for assessing the effects of RFA on HCC by combining contrast-enhanced (CE) US and real-time virtual sonography with three-dimensional US data. PATIENTS AND METHODS: Before RFA, we performed a sweep scan of the target HCC nodule and the surrounding hepatic parenchyma to generate three-dimensional US data. After RFA, we synchronized multi-planar reconstruction images derived from stored three-dimensional US data with real-time US images on the same US monitor and performed CEUS and real-time virtual sonography. Using a marking function, we drew a sphere marker along the target HCC nodule contour on pre-treatment US- multi-planar reconstruction images so that the automatically synchronized sphere marker represented the original HCC nodule contour on post-treatment real-time CEUS images. Ablation was considered sufficient when an avascular area with a margin of several millimeters in all directions surrounded the sphere marker on CEUS. RESULTS: This method was feasible and useful for assessing therapeutic effects in 13 consecutive patients with HCC who underwent RFA. In 2 patients who underwent multiple sessions of RFA, HCC-nodule portions requiring additional RFA were easily identified on US images. CONCLUSIONS: This method using advanced US technologies will facilitate assessment of the effects of RFA on HCC.

BACKGROUND: Chronic ingestion of ethanol increases acetaldehyde and leads to the production of acetaldehyde-derived advanced glycation end-products (AA-AGE). We evaluated the toxicity of AA-AGE on hepatocytes and studied the role of AA-AGE in the pathogenesis of alcoholic liver disease (ALD). METHODS: Rat hepatocyte cultures were treated with N-ethyllysine (NEL) or AA-AGE and the cell viability was evaluated using MTT assay. Male Wistar rats were fed with liquid diet containing 5% ethanol for 8 weeks following normal diet for another 12 weeks. A group of animals was sacrificed at 4th, 6th, and 8th week and the remaining animals at 12th, 14th, 16th, 18th, and 20th week. The liver sections were stained for AA-AGE and 4-hydroxy-2-nonenal (4-HNE). Liver biopsy obtained from ALD patients was also stained for AA-AGE and 4-HNE. RESULTS: Hepatocyte viability was significantly reduced in cultures treated with AA-AGE compared to NEL treated or control cultures. Severe fatty degeneration was observed during chronic administration of ethanol increasing from 4-8 weeks. The staining of AA-AGE and 4-HNE was correlated with the degree of ALD in both rat and human. In rats, hepatic fatty degeneration was completely disappeared and the staining for both AA-AGE and 4-HNE returned to normal at 12th week of abstinence. Staining for AA-AGE and 4-HNE was completely absent in normal human liver. CONCLUSIONS: The data demonstrated that AA-AGE is toxic to hepatocytes, but not NEL. Chronic ethanol ingestion produces AA-AGE and reactive oxygen species that contribute to the pathogenesis of ALD. Abstinence of alcohol results in complete disappearance of both AA-AGE and 4-HNE along with fatty degeneration suggesting that AA-AGE plays a significant role in the pathogenesis of ALD.

Inorganic-binding peptides, which exhibit specific binding affinity to an inorganic material, are versatile building blocks in the construction of novel bio-conjugated materials. However, very little knowledge regarding their adsorbed structures on the target material is currently available. In this article, we report on the single-molecule analysis of such polypeptides by scanning tunneling microscopy (STM). The adsorbed structure of a gold-binding peptide (GBP) on Au(111) was observed at the single-molecule level. FTIR spectroscopy revealed the helical structure of the GBP, and ab initio calculations confirmed the correlation between the observed STM image and a sample helical structure. It has been demonstrated that the conformational structure of the polypeptide is highly pre-organized, allowing favorable binding onto the gold surface. Gaining such an insight into the relation between the structure and the binding function of the peptide leads to a fundamental understanding of inorganic-binding peptide, and, consequently, to a rational design of these peptides.
